Just received updated 1099B for 2020 and it affects the loss carry over for 2021 return. Can I correct them at the same time?
So, I just received an updated 1099B and 1099DIV for the 2020 return. It reduces my loss, but also reduces the taxable dividend (recharacterized as return of capital) and I am due about $200 back for 2020. However, this will affect 2021 return (I will probably need to pay some money) due to the different loss carry over ($200-300 difference, so a small effect on the taxable amount).
Do I need to correct 2020, file, wait for it to be accepted and the file the corrected for 2021? or can I file them at the same time? I assume that I will have to write them a check for 2021, and I will be due a refund on 2020 once they process it.
Also, I used TurboTax Desktop for both returns. Is it possible to do the correction electronically?
